1959 Volkswagen Beetle Custom Coachbuilt Coupe | Red
One-off build. Show-quality execution. Collector-grade presentation.
This 1959 Volkswagen Beetle has been transformed into a custom, hand-built coachbuilt coupe on an original Beetle chassis.
This is not a factory VW model and not a Hebmüller—it is a true custom steel-body coupe, executed at a high level and presented in exceptional condition.
Engine & Drivetrain Specifications
Engine Type: Air-cooled, horizontally opposed 4-cylinder (Boxer)
Displacement: 1.2L (1192 cc) — period-correct for 1959 Beetle platform
Fuel System: Carbureted
Cooling: Air-cooled
Configuration: Rear-mounted
Output: Approx. 36 horsepower (factory-spec range)
Transmission: Manual
Drivetrain: Rear-wheel drive
Value Profile: Simple, reliable, globally serviceable powertrain
